  1. Re:Why large files by Anonymous Coward · · Score: 5, Interesting

    Real analytical work can easily produce files this large. Output for analyses of structures with more than half a million elements and several million degrees of freedom can EASILY produce output of over two gigs. Yes, these results can and should be split, but sometimes it makes sense to keep them together as a matter of convenience. Plus, there IS a small performance hit when dealing with multiple files on most of the major FEA packages.

  2. Re:Why large files by CoolVibe · · Score: 5, Interesting
    raw video can easily exceed 2 GB in size. Why raw video? Because (like others said) it's easier to edit. Then you encode to MPEG2, which will shrink the size somewhat (usually still bigger than 2 GB, ever dumped a DVD to disk?), so it'll be "small" enough to burn onto a DVD or somesuch. Oh, editing 3 hours of raw wave data also chews away at the disk size. Also, since you need to READ the data from the media to see if it looks nice, you need to have support for those big files as well. Right, now why don't we need files bigger than 2 GB again? Well?
